Condition Coverage

blib/lib/Graph/Grammar.pm
Criterion Covered Total %
condition 16 24 66.6


and 3 conditions

line !l l&&!r l&&r condition
118 3 2 3 @rule and builtin::blessed($rule[-1])
5 0 3 @rule and builtin::blessed($rule[-1]) and $rule[-1]->isa("Graph::Grammar::Rule::NoMoreVertices")
132 18 6 18 $no_more_vertices and $graph->degree($vertex) > $neighbours
138 18 0 12 builtin::blessed($neighbour_rule) and $neighbour_rule->isa("Graph::Grammar::Rule::Edge")
141 6 0 12 $i and builtin::blessed($rule[$i - 1])
6 0 12 $i and builtin::blessed($rule[$i - 1]) and $rule[$i - 1]->isa("Graph::Grammar::Rule::Edge")
143 0 0 14 not $matching_neighbours->has($_) and &$neighbour_rule($graph, $_)
165 15 0 0 $DEBUG and $overlaps